Abstract


The Legok-Karawaci highway has a length of 8.8 km that connects the Lippo Karawaci area with Summarecon Serpong, Paramount Serpong and BSD (Bumi Serpong Damai). This road functions as a primary local road, and is categorized as a class III C road. Based on UU No. 38 of 2004 concerning local roads, class III C road is a public road that functions to serve local transportation with the characteristics of short distance travel, low average speed, and unlimited number of entrances, while the road segment is traversed by many heavy vehicles with overload loads. This causes the road to have a rate of decline that is faster than the design life that was determined at the beginning of planning. This study aims to determine the rate of decline in pavement life on the Legok - Karawaci highway, Tangerang Regency by assessing the remaining service life of the road using the 1993 AASTHO method, while the axle load analysis will use MDP 2017. The designed CESA plan is 2.129.641.358 for a period of 20 years while the actual condition is 3.306.170.722. There was an increase in CESA of 1.176.529.364. The increase in CESA value is influenced by the increase in traffic growth factors that occur in actual conditions. With this condition, the service life of the road is reduced. The pavement of Legok Kab.Tangerang road is experiencing a decrease in the design life due to traffic of passing vehicles so that there is an overload. The results of the RL (Remaining Life) calculation in actual conditions show that with actual traffic conditions, the road pavement cannot serve traffic for 20 years. Service life in actual conditions only reaches 16 years with a decrease in road service life on average for 20 years is 16.78%.
